How Much Does an Associate DVM make?

Associate DVM made a median salary around $114,924 in March, 2025. The best-paid 25 percent made $145,690 probably that year, while the lowest-paid 25 percent made around $90,636.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ession. Best-Paying States for Associate DVM

The states and districts that pay Associate DVM the highest salary are District of Columbia (around $125,034) , California (around $123,911) , New Jersey (around $123,125) , Alaska (around $122,338) , and Massachusetts (around $122,226) .

Doctor of Veterinary Medicine (DVM) - Average Salary $112,700
The Doctor of Veterinary Medicine (DVM) performs check-up exams. Diagnoses and treats animal disease or injuries. Being a Doctor of Veterinary Medicine (DVM) performs surgeries. Utilizes diagnostic laboratory tests, x-rays, sonography and other tools to determine treatments for animals. In addition, Doctor of Veterinary Medicine (DVM) advises animal owners about preventative care, diet, vaccines, and behavioral conditions. Prescribes medications and treatment protocols. Consults with other veterinary specialists as needed. Requires a doctorate degree in Veterinary Medicine. Requires an applicable state license to practice.Typ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. Doctor of Veterinary Medicine (DVM)'s years of experience requirement may be unspecified. Certification and/or licensing in the position's specialty is the main requirement.
